Abstract

In this paper, we investigate Starobinky’s inflation model for scalar perturbation during cosmic inflation epoch by using Arnowitt-Deser-Misner (ADM) formalism. We implemented this formalism to the action of curvature-scalar of Starobinsky’s model, which is one of the models of cosmic inflation. As the result of this investigation, we found the power spectrum of scalar perturbation in the form of Starobinsky’s inflation model which has a linear correlation to the comoving Hubble radius which is shrinking during inflation epoch.
